      Change error reporting to have an explicit type · ffa8666a
      Pieter Noordhuis authored
      When there is an I/O error, errno should be used to find out what is
      wrong. In other cases, errno cannot be used. So, use an explicit type in
      Hiredis to define the different error scenarios that can occur.
